摘 要:在对大规格H型钢研究的基础上,提出超大H型钢的轧制方法。并利用有限元分析软件ANSYS/LS-DYNA,对不同尺寸的理想来料进行了有限元模拟。最后,通过实验室模拟实验进一步验证了超大H型钢轧制方法的合理性、可行性,为超大H型钢孔型设计和轧制生产积累了参考数据。The slab cut-dividing rolling method of ultra-large H-beam was introduced in details, which is based on study of large H-beam. In order to obtain accurate dimensions on design of passes of new groove, various supposition billets were conducted by finite element method with ANSYS/LS-DYNA software. At last,the ultra-large H-beam rolling experiments were performed in the rolling mill of laboratory with lead and the roll pass scale is 1 : 8 according to the actual size of the H-beam. The experimental work was finished smoothly and precision of the final product is perfect. The experiments prove that the rolling technology of the cut-dividing of slab is feasible and roll pass system is reliable. The results will offer reliable rolling parameters for the actual produce in future.
